What is an automation robotics job?
An Automation Robotics job involves designing, developing, and maintaining robotic systems that automate tasks in industries like manufacturing, healthcare, and logistics. Professionals in this role work with hardware, software, and control systems to improve efficiency, precision, and safety. They may program robotic arms, integrate sensors, and troubleshoot automation processes. Strong knowledge of robotics engineering, programming, and AI is often required.
What does a typical day look like for someone working in automation robotics?
A typical day in Automation Robotics often involves designing and programming robotic systems, troubleshooting equipment, and collaborating with engineers and technicians to optimize automated processes. You may spend time conducting system tests, integrating new machinery, or responding to production issues on the manufacturing floor. Regularly, you’ll also participate in team meetings, document project progress, and ensure compliance with safety standards. The work is dynamic and hands-on, requiring both technical expertise and effective communication with cross-functional teams.
What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in automation robotics, and why are they important?
To thrive in Automation Robotics, a strong background in mechanical or electrical engineering, programming (such as PLC, Python, or C++), and robotics system integration is essential, often supported by a relevant degree. Familiarity with industrial automation platforms, robotic arms, machine vision systems, and certifications like FANUC or ABB robotics are typically expected. Excellent problem-solving, collaboration, and communication skills help professionals navigate complex technical issues and work effectively with multidisciplinary teams. These competencies ensure efficient design, implementation, and maintenance of automated systems that drive productivity and innovation in industrial settings.

What You'll Do
As an Extrusion Blow Molding Process Technician, you'll be responsible for setting up, operating, optimizing, and maintaining extrusion blow molding equipment to ensure safe, efficient production of high-quality plastic products.
Key Responsibilities
- Set up and start extrusion blow molding (EBM) machines according to production schedules.
- Perform mold changes, tooling changeovers, and equipment setup safely and efficiently.
- Install and align molds, tooling, and machine components to ensure optimal production performance.
- Adjust machine parameters including temperatures, blow pressure, cycle times, parison settings, and other processing parameters to optimize quality and productivity.
- Monitor machine performance and make process adjustments to maintain consistent production and product quality.
- Troubleshoot molding, tooling, material, and process issues to minimize downtime.
- Perform routine preventive maintenance on extrusion blow molding equipment, molds, tooling, and associated production equipment.
- Troubleshoot and support secondary manufacturing equipment including leak testers, sealers, reamers, conveyors, and related downstream equipment.
- Perform first-piece inspections and support ongoing product quality verification.
- Maintain accurate setup, production, maintenance, and process documentation.
- Work closely with production, maintenance, automation, engineering, and quality teams to improve equipment reliability and manufacturing performance.
- Follow all safety, quality, and Good Manufacturing Practice (GMP) requirements.
- Support continuous improvement initiatives that improve safety, quality, productivity, and operational excellence.
